When considering your budget for getting a house, you most likely concentrate on the deposit as well as regular monthly home mortgage repayment. But as a future home owner, these aren't the only expenses you must consider.



Prices will differ, and also while some may just impact your pocketbook as soon as, others might be routine and also might need to factor into your normal budget. Some costs will certainly be predictable, while others can appear without much caution. Having a concept of what expenses to anticipate can help protect against sticker shock and help you prepare.

(It can likewise clue you into future upkeep prices. A lot more on these expenses later.) Inspections generally cost between $281 as well as $402, however this action could conserve you thousands. During an evaluation, you may discover issues with the home's mechanical systems, physical framework or home appliances, enabling you to renegotiate the market price or have the vendor fix the problem.





The last step the closing can be discouraging. Closing costs are usually 2% to 5% of the funding amount. For a $350,000 mortgage, this would place shutting costs around $7,000 to $17,500. A number of expenses go right into closing, including lender charges. Unlike many lenders, Ally House does not charge application, origination, processing or underwriting charges.



In some situations, assessment and evaluation expenses are consisted of in your closing prices, yet not always.
